Yelachenahalli metro station is located across Kanakapura Road. It's located between Yelechenahalli and Konakakunte suburbs that lies on either sides of Kanakapura Road. Next to the Yelachenahalli Metro station, stands the electrical switch yard for the metro line. This area was earlier occupied by Shravanthi Kalyana Mantapa. The land was acquired by Namma Metro to build the Puttenahalli Metro Station.

Once operational, it will help the residents to commute straight to Majestic Station. Currently, the BMTC buses ply across this route mostly end in KR Market. As a result, residents had to switch at Banashankari or JP Nagar 6th Phase to catch the BMTC buses to Majestic and other parts of the city.

Yelachenahalli Metro station will also serve the residents of Reserve Bank Layout, Kumaraswamy Layout, ISRO Layout, which are typically with in 30 mts radius of the metro station. Residents beyond Konakunte, like Kaggalipura and beyond will also benefit from this Metro station.

The metro station was initially named Puttenahalli Metro station. The station being closer to Yelachenahalli than Puttenahalli, was renamed to Yelachenahalli Metro station in July 2016, prior to commencement of operations on this stretch of the metro line.
